Te āheinga: The opportunity

Wanting a chance to build your career within the building sector? Then our building team has the role for you. This varied role involves educating the community, onsite inspections, monitoring, information gathering, advice and legislative work.

Some tasks consist of:

  • Building Warrant of Fitness Compliance and Audits
  • Swimming Pool Inspections
  • Monitoring and Enforcement
    • Relocatable dwellings
    • Derelict and Dangerous Buildings
    • General By-law and Consent compliance support
